安装 MySQL 后服务无法启动怎么解决

2025-01-14 23:25:14   小编

安装MySQL后服务无法启动怎么解决

在开发和使用数据库的过程中,不少用户会遇到安装MySQL后服务无法启动的问题,这无疑会给工作带来诸多困扰。下面我们就来探讨一下常见的原因及对应的解决方法。

端口冲突是一个常见原因。MySQL默认使用3306端口,如果该端口被其他程序占用,MySQL服务将无法正常启动。解决这个问题,我们可以通过命令行查看占用3306端口的程序。在Windows系统下,打开命令提示符,输入“netstat -ano | findstr :3306”,这会列出占用该端口的进程ID。接着,使用“tasklist | findstr [进程ID]”命令找到对应的程序名称。然后,我们可以选择停止该程序,或者更改MySQL的默认端口。修改MySQL配置文件(通常是my.ini或my.cnf),找到“port = 3306”这一行,将端口号修改为其他未被占用的端口,保存后重启MySQL服务。

MySQL的配置文件可能存在错误。不正确的参数设置、语法错误等都可能导致服务无法启动。仔细检查配置文件,特别是关于数据库存储路径、字符集等设置。可以尝试恢复到默认配置,或者与正确的配置文件进行对比,找出错误所在并进行修正。

另外,服务依赖项问题也可能导致MySQL服务无法启动。MySQL依赖一些系统服务和组件,如果这些依赖项没有正常运行,MySQL服务也会受到影响。确保系统中的相关服务,如网络服务、系统管理工具等都正常运行。

还有一种情况是权限问题。如果在安装或启动MySQL服务时使用的用户权限不足,也可能导致服务无法启动。尝试使用管理员权限启动MySQL服务。

最后,如果上述方法都不能解决问题,可能是MySQL安装过程中出现了错误。这种情况下,可以考虑卸载MySQL,清理残留文件和注册表信息,然后重新进行安装,安装过程中确保所有步骤都正确无误。

通过对以上这些常见原因的排查和解决,相信大多数MySQL服务无法启动的问题都能得到妥善处理,让我们能够顺利使用MySQL数据库进行开发和管理工作。

TAGS: MySQL安装 MySQL服务修复 MySQL服务启动问题 服务启动故障排查

欢迎使用万千站长工具!

Welcome to www.zzTool.com